Choosing the Right Trundle Bed Frame

When choosing a trundle bed, consider the available bedroom space, the mattress sizes required and how often the additional sleeping surface will be used. You should also check the overall dimensions of the bed and the clearance needed to pull the trundle out.

Always check the individual product specifications for mattress size, mattress depth, weight capacity and intended use before ordering.

Trundle Bed Size Guide

Trundle beds are available in different sizes, with the required mattress dimensions varying between individual designs. Many models use Single-size sleeping surfaces.

  • Small Single – Approximately 75cm x 190cm
  • Single – Approximately 90cm x 190cm

The main bed and pull-out trundle may require different mattress sizes or depths. Always check the individual product specifications before purchasing a mattress.

Trundle Bed Frame FAQs

What is a trundle bed?

A trundle bed is a bed frame with an additional sleeping surface stored underneath the main bed. The lower bed can be pulled out when extra sleeping space is required.

Are trundle beds good for small bedrooms?

Yes. Trundle beds can be particularly useful in smaller bedrooms because the additional sleeping surface is stored underneath the main bed when it is not needed.

Are trundle beds suitable for children?

Yes. Trundle beds are a popular choice for children's bedrooms, particularly where an additional bed is useful for sleepovers or visiting friends.

Does a trundle bed need two mattresses?

If the trundle provides an additional sleeping surface, it will generally require its own mattress. The required size and mattress depth vary between models.

Can I use any mattress on a trundle bed?

No. The mattress must meet the size and maximum depth requirements of the individual bed. This is particularly important for the lower mattress to ensure it fits underneath the main bed.

Are trundle beds suitable for everyday use?

This depends on the individual design. Some trundle beds are intended primarily for occasional use, while others can provide regular sleeping accommodation. Always check the manufacturer's specifications.
